Output 1b7620633beb423b4730dfd3564fb360ca641fedd2c578b483af3d376741c8e5:16

value
12052131
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0cbd76e49f54005abaf597e02e4e1512d321542c OP_EQUAL
address
32rP14iK8pFfHjBUopFSeF7t1nVD4Waaqu
transaction
1b7620633beb423b4730dfd3564fb360ca641fedd2c578b483af3d376741c8e5
confirmations
553241
spent
true